Tích hợp này cho phép bạn kết nối Botpress chatbot với Shopify, một nền tảng thương mại điện tử hàng đầu. Với sự tích hợp này, bạn có thể tạo điều kiện cho các tương tác liền mạch liên quan đến hoạt động của cửa hàng trực tiếp từ chatbot của mình. Để sử dụng hiệu quả tiện ích tích hợp, bạn cần cung cấp tên cửa hàng Shopify (như trong trình duyệt/URL) và mã truy cập được tạo sau khi tạo ứng dụng Shopify. ## Video cài đặt [! [hình ảnh] (https://i.imgur.com/mWb0uV9.png)] (https://youtu.be/yjvsoaCvjmU) ## Thiết lập cấu hình Để thiết lập tích hợp Shopify trong Botpress, các cấu hình sau là bắt buộc: 1. **Tên cửa hàng / cửa hàng **: Tìm thấy trong URL khi truy cập cửa hàng Shopify của bạn. Ví dụ: nếu URL đến quản trị viên cửa hàng của bạn là \'https://admin.shopify.com/store/botpress-test-store\', sau đó tên cửa hàng bạn sẽ nhập là \'botpress-test-store\'. 2. **API Access Token**: Mã thông báo này rất cần thiết để cho phép Botpress để liên lạc với cửa hàng Shopify. Để nhận token, bạn cần tạo ứng dụng Shopify mới (hướng dẫn bên dưới). ## Tạo ứng dụng Shopify 1. Đi tới 'Ứng dụng và kênh bán hàng' trong trang tổng quan của Shopify. 2. Nhấp vào 'Phát triển ứng dụng'. 3. Chọn 'Tạo ứng dụng' và đặt tên cho ứng dụng của bạn. 4. Nhấp vào 'Thông tin xác thực API' và trong 'Mã truy cập', chọn 'Định cấu hình phạm vi API quản trị' 5. Để tích hợp này, bạn sẽ cần chọn hộp truy cập 'Đọc' cho 'Khách hàng', 'Đơn đặt hàng' và 'Sản phẩm'. Điều này sẽ cung cấp cho bot quyền truy cập để đọc từng thuộc tính này. 6. Nhấp vào 'Lưu' và sau đó 'Cài đặt ứng dụng' để hoàn tất cài đặt của bạn. 7. Sau khi cài đặt, bạn có thể đi tới 'Thông tin xác thực API' và 'Mã truy cập API quản trị' để xem / sao chép mã thông báo của mình. ## Bật tích hợp Để kích hoạt tích hợp Shopify trong Botpress: 1. Truy cập Botpress Bảng điều khiển quản trị. 2. Chuyển đến tab "Tích hợp". 3. Tìm kiếm tích hợp Shopify và chọn "Bật" hoặc "Cấu hình". 4. Nhập mã truy cập Cửa hàng/Tên cửa hàng và API quản trị viên bắt buộc. 5. Lưu cấu hình của bạn. ## Sử dụng ### Hành động Sau khi bật tích hợp, Botpress chatbot có thể giao tiếp với Shopify cho các truy vấn về sản phẩm và khách hàng bằng các thao tác dưới đây: - Get Customer List: Trả về danh sách khách hàng. - Nhận danh sách đơn hàng của khách hàng: Trả về danh sách đơn đặt hàng cho một khách hàng cụ thể theo trạng thái (mở, đóng, hủy hoặc bất kỳ). - Nhận danh sách sản phẩm: Trả về danh sách các sản phẩm sử dụng Id, Tiêu đề hoặc Loại sản phẩm. - Nhận danh sách mẫu mã sản phẩm: Trả về danh sách các mẫu mã của sản phẩm theo Id. ### Sự kiện Sau khi bật tích hợp, chatbot Botpres của bạn có thể nhận các sự kiện từ Shopify bằng cách sử dụng các sự kiện bên dưới: - Lệnh đã tạo: Được kích hoạt khi lệnh được tạo. - Cập nhật đơn hàng: Được kích hoạt khi lệnh được cập nhật. - Đơn hàng bị hủy: Được kích hoạt khi đơn hàng bị hủy. - Customer Created: Được kích hoạt khi khách hàng được tạo. - Cập nhật khách hàng: Được kích hoạt khi khách hàng được cập nhật. Lưu ý: Bạn không thể liên kết các sự kiện này với các cuộc trò chuyện cụ thể. Những sự kiện này là để lưu trữ thông tin sự kiện trong chatbot của bạn (ví dụ: lưu trữ dữ liệu khách hàng / đơn hàng trong bảng để truy vấn) ## Hạn chế 1. API của Shopify có thể áp dụng giới hạn tốc độ. 2. Các sự kiện không liên quan đến các cuộc trò chuyện.
Tạo ra những trải nghiệm tuyệt vời cho tác nhân AI.